视觉算法:探索图像处理与计算机视觉的前沿技术

大家好,欢迎来到这篇关于视觉算法的文章。在当今数字化时代,图像处理和计算机视觉技术正以惊人的速度发展。从人脸识别到自动驾驶,从医学影像分析到虚拟现实,视觉算法已经渗透到我们生活的各个领域。本文将带您深入了解视觉算法的前沿技术,探索其在图像处理和计算机视觉中的应用。

一、深度学习与卷积神经网络

深度学习:探索视觉算法的未来

深度学习是一种基于神经网络的机器学习方法,它以其出色的性能和灵活的表达能力在图像处理和计算机视觉领域取得了巨大成功。卷积神经网络(CNN)作为深度学习的核心算法之一,被广泛应用于图像分类、目标检测和语义分割等任务。通过多层卷积和池化操作,CNN可以自动提取图像中的特征,从而实现高精度的图像识别和分析。

二、目标检测与物体识别

目标检测:从图像中找到我们感兴趣的物体

目标检测是计算机视觉中的一个重要任务,它旨在从图像中准确地定位和识别出特定的物体。近年来,基于深度学习的目标检测方法取得了巨大的突破,如基于区域的卷积神经网络(R-CNN)和单阶段检测器(YOLO)等。这些方法不仅能够实现高精度的目标检测,还具有实时性能,为自动驾驶、智能安防等领域的应用提供了强大的支持。

三、图像语义分割与实例分割

图像语义分割:解析图像中的每个像素

图像语义分割是将图像中的每个像素分配到特定的语义类别中,从而实现对图像的细粒度理解。深度学习方法在图像语义分割中取得了显著的成果,如全卷积网络(FCN)和语义分割网络(SegNet)等。这些方法不仅能够实现高精度的图像语义分割,还能够应用于医学影像分析、智能交通等领域。

四、人脸识别与表情分析

人脸识别:从图像中辨识出熟悉的面孔

人脸识别是计算机视觉中的一个热门研究方向,它旨在通过图像或视频中的人脸特征来辨识出个体的身份。深度学习方法在人脸识别中取得了突破性进展,如基于深度学习的人脸验证和人脸识别系统。表情分析作为人脸识别的一个重要应用领域,也得到了广泛研究和应用。

五、虚拟现实与增强现实

虚拟现实:创造一个全新的视觉体验

虚拟现实(VR)和增强现实(AR)是近年来备受关注的技术,它们通过将虚拟对象与真实世界进行融合,创造出一种全新的视觉体验。视觉算法在虚拟现实和增强现实中发挥着至关重要的作用,如实时姿态估计、虚拟物体渲染、虚拟场景重建等。这些技术不仅为游戏和娱乐带来了极大的乐趣,还在医学、教育等领域发挥了重要的作用。

六、未来展望与挑战

未来展望:视觉算法的挑战与机遇

随着技术的不断进步和应用的不断拓展,视觉算法面临着许多挑战和机遇。其中,数据集的质量和规模、模型的可解释性和鲁棒性、计算资源的限制等是当前视觉算法研究中亟待解决的问题。未来,我们可以通过进一步研究和创新,推动视觉算法在图像处理和计算机视觉领域的发展,并为人类社会带来更多的便利和创新。

通过对视觉算法的探索,我们可以看到图像处理和计算机视觉技术在不断发展和创新。深度学习、目标检测、图像语义分割、人脸识别、虚拟现实等领域的进展为我们提供了更广阔的应用前景和研究方向。未来,我们期待视觉算法能够继续突破技术瓶颈,为人类社会带来更多的惊喜和创新。让我们共同期待视觉算法的未来!

延伸阅读: